Birdy showed up on the horizon earlier this year with her cover version of Skinny Love. I liked that one a bit better than the original one and it made me curious what else there might be…

Though the name birdy might sound a bit cheesy (and probably is), the album is quite OK. You get a healthy mix of vocals and piano, as other have done before as well. The album is filled with cover songs, interpretations of well-known artists without slaughtering and ripping them into pieces.

Birdy will remind you a bit of Sia. And I wouldn’t be surprise if in a couple of years she’s heading into the same direction.

This is music for the cold winter evenings, when you’re alone at home. Sia as well…
